Who is Forgiveness Really For?

I used to think forgiving someone meant that you had to embrace that person. It doesn’t mean that at all. I don’t think it’s an emotional thing at all… I think it’s a decision. I used to think that it was saying… Oh it’s ok… to whatever nasty thing someone said of did… I don’t believe that any more either. It’s not saying the words or behavior are ok at all. I used to think that it was for the other person… I no longer believe that either. It’s for you. It’s to release you from the toxic situation. It releases you from anger. Forgiveness releases you from whatever hateful cyclical situation that is going on, or has gone on.

This is a bit different than when someone asks you to forgive them. The forgiveness I am speaking about is when you forgive someone without them asking. It’s not anything the other person needs to know about at all. This is something within yourself, releasing you from the situation. It also removes whatever power they have over you. Because when you refuse to forgive, you empower the person/persons/situation. You give them power over you.

Forgiving them Frees You!
